Book Synopsis

They’ll all be crow bait by the time I’m finished...

Jail was hell for Davie McCall. Ten years down the line, freedom’s no picnic either. It’s 1990, there are new kings in the West of Scotland underworld, and Glasgow is awash with drugs.

Davie can handle himself. What he can’t handle is the memory of his mother’s death at the hand of his sadistic father. Or the darkness his father implanted deep in his own psyche. Or the nightmares…

Now his father is back in town and after blood, ready to waste anyone who stops him hacking out a piece of the action. There are people in his way.

And Davie is one of them.
